Transparent Diagnostic & Repair Pricing
Our diagnostic fee is $35.00 for standard (brand-name) PCs and $95.00 for custom-built PCs/Gaming.
We do not bill by the hour. Instead, after diagnosis, we provide a flat-rate proposal that includes the full cost of repairs, no surprises. The proposal will be emailed to you for approval before any work begins.
